Marietta Investment Partners LLC Invests $1.75 Million in iShares MSCI South Korea ETF $EWY

Marietta Investment Partners LLC acquired a new stake in iShares MSCI South Korea ETF (NYSEARCA:EWYFree Report) in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und acquired 14,190 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ock, valued at approximately $1,746,000.

iShares MSCI South Korea 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

iShares MSCI South Korea Capped ETF (the Fund) is an exchange-traded fund (ETF). The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the MSCI Korea 25/50 Index (the Index). The Index consists of stocks traded primarily on the Stock Market Division of the Korean Exchange. The Index is a free-float adjusted market capitalization weighted index with a capping methodology applied to issuer weights so that no issuer of a component exceeds 25% of the Index weight and all issuers with weight above 5% do not exceed 50% of the Index weight.
